Abstract:

This paper described how to use VC++ mixed programming with MATLAB to realize the detection system of button cell brand. It introduced the principle of its composition, and specifically describes the means to achieve it. A more intuitive man-machine interface was programmed by VC++ mixed programming with MATLAB, it developed a software system of visual inspection .The detection and recognition of button cell brand can be achieved through image acquisition of cell and transmission by the CCD camera. An experiment in 2 years proves it runs in a good condition with this detection system of button cell brand.
